The interaction of warfarin with antacid constituents in the gut
Authors:J C McElnay  D W G Harron  P F D'Arcy  P S Collier
Institution:(1) Department of Pharmacy, The Queen's University of Belfast, Medical Biology Centre, 97 Lisburn Road, BT9 7BL Belfast, N. Ireland
Abstract:Summary A study was made of the effect of 4 constituents of antacid preparations on the absorption of the coumarin derivate warfarin sodium using an in vitro experimental model. The constituents tested were activated dimethicone (a silicone) magnesium trisilicate, bismuth carbonate and the adsorbant, kaolin. Slight decreased intestinal absorption was shown by magnesium trisilicate (19%) and bismuth carbonate (7%), the other 2 components showing no effects.
